Before we get into the steps, we would like to talk about compatibility. Not all games will support the use of controllers. That being said, most shooter and racing mobile games will be compatible with your PS4 controller. Some users suggest using third-party key mapper software for incompatible games. However, you may face a ban as most mobile video games don’t tolerate the use of third-party background applications. Plus, you will need to make sure whether your phone’s OS is compatible with your PS controller’s model. Here’s more information regarding the same:

Controller Model Name Compatible OS
DUALSHOCK 4 wireless controller Android 10, iOS 13, iPadOS 13, tvOS 13, macOS Catalina

Connect your PS4 controller to Android and iOS devices in this way

Connecting your DUALSHOCK 4 wireless (PS4) controller to your Android or iOS mobile phone will require Bluetooth. Follow these steps:-
1) Firstly, make sure that the light bar on your PS4 controller is switched off. If not, press and hold the PS button until it turns off. Also, disconnect any USB cable from your controller.
2) Now, press and hold the SHARE and PS buttons together until the light bar starts flashing.
3) You can now enable Bluetooth on your mobile device and look for this controller’s name in the list.
4) Tap on the controller’s name (will be similar to DUALSHOCK 4 wireless controller) to initiate pairing.

PS4 Controller Android iOS

Note: PS controllers can be paired to only one device at a time. So, each time you change devices, you will have to perform the pairing process again. Also, if you use third-party controllers for PS4, we cannot guarantee its compatibility with Android or iOS devices. In such cases, check the manufacturer’s manual or contact support for help and instructions.
